Kate apparently broke her foot when she fell down a flight of stairs and became housebound. She then decided to focus on her songwriting and start a career in music. After uploading her music to Myspace, Lily Allen placed Kate in her "top 8." Since then, her music has exploded over the UK. Thank goodness for that broken foot.
